What does Takeda pay a Scientist on an H-1B?

$124k Takeda has filed 30 H-1B labor condition applications for the role of Scientist with the U.S. Department of Labor between FY2021 and FY2026 at a median base salary of $124k. Most of those filings fall between $118k and $126k. Base salary is the wage stated on the filing, not total compensation.
